Book Overview

Graduating in liberal arts? You're better prepared for the job market than you may realize. Corporations today are looking for employees who can see the big picture, whose broad field of study has trained them to understand and think critically about people, cultures and society. In short, liberal arts majors Now, human resources expert Gregory Giangrande takes you to the other side of the interviewer's desk and reveals insider tips and techniques, especially for liberal arts majors, that really make interviewers sit up and take notice. Here's how to find the right company, create the perfect resume, land a hard to-get interview, make the most of that all-important meeting, and lots more. THE LIBERAL ARTS ADVANTAGE gives you An insiders' look At specific opportunities for liberal arts graduates in publishing, broadcasting, journalism, advertising, and other industries and shows you how to target your job search for the exact career that's right for you. What kinds of positions are available in a particular business? What can you expect to earn? What about the corporate culture, the typical work week, the prospects for advancement? Casting Light on the Liberal Arts

Liberal Arts Advantage is for anyone who has been misinformed about the quality of a liberal arts degree. Giangrande gives us the honest truth (which is positive, not negative) about the importance and value of being a liberal arts major/graduate. He tells you what fields and professions love to hire liberal majors. He also points out the strengths liberal majors have over technical or specialized majors education-wise and career-wise. The reader will be not only welcomed and encouraged, but also proud of his/her wise choice to pursue (or have pursued) a liberal education. After reading the book, I asked myself, "Why would someone NOT want to pursue a liberal arts degree?" I only wish I had read this book before I majored in Accounting. Like Giagrande suggests, follow your heart and happiness will surely come.
